Question
which statements are true about exponential functions? choose three correct answers.
the range always includes negative numbers.
the graph has a horizontal asymptote at ( x = 0 ).
the input to an exponential function is the exponent.
the base represents the multiplicative rate of change.
the domain is all real numbers.
Brief Explanations
- For exponential functions of the form $f(x)=b^x$ where $b>0, b
eq1$:
- The domain is all real numbers, as any real number can be used as the exponent.
- The input (the independent variable $x$) is indeed the exponent in the standard form.
- The base $b$ is related to the multiplicative rate of change: for growth/decay, the rate is tied to $b$ (e.g., $b=1+r$ for growth rate $r$).
- Incorrect statements:
- The range is all positive real numbers, so it does not include negative numbers.
- The horizontal asymptote is at $y=0$, not $x=0$.
